Mexican Fan Palm (Washingtonia robusta) Seedling.

Key Features

  • Height: Grows rapidly to a height of 70-100 feet (21-30 meters), making it one of the tallest ornamental palms.
  • Fronds: Large, fan-shaped fronds that can reach up to 5 feet (1.5 meters) wide, creating a lush canopy.
  • Trunk: Slender, slightly tapering, and typically brownish-gray with a rough texture.
  • Flowers: Produces small, white flowers on long inflorescences, blooming in spring and summer.
  • Fruits: Round, black berries that attract wildlife such as birds and small mammals.

Introduction

The Mexican Fan Palm, scientifically known as Washingtonia robusta, is a fast-growing, tropical palm tree native to northwestern Mexico. Known for its towering height and fan-shaped fronds, it has become a popular landscape choice in warm climates worldwide, especially in urban and coastal areas, due to its striking silhouette and ability to thrive in various environmental conditions.



Benefits

  • Aesthetic Appeal: Adds a tropical, luxurious feel to landscapes, ideal for both residential and commercial properties.
  • Wildlife Habitat: Provides food and shelter for various birds and pollinators.
  • Drought-Tolerant: Once established, the palm is highly resistant to drought, making it a sustainable choice in arid regions.
  • Wind Resistance: Known for withstanding strong winds, making it suitable for coastal and windy areas.
  • Low Maintenance: Requires minimal care, as it can adapt to a range of soil conditions and does not need frequent pruning.

Growth Conditions

  • Climate: Prefers warm, subtropical to tropical climates (USDA Zones 9-11) but can tolerate mild frosts.
  • Sunlight: Requires full sun for optimal growth, but it can also adapt to partial shade.
  • Soil: Grows best in well-draining, sandy or loamy soils but is adaptable to various soil types, including clay.
  • Watering: Regular watering is needed during the initial stages, but it becomes drought-tolerant as it matures.
  • Pruning: Occasional pruning of old, brown fronds to maintain a clean appearance.
